KW V2's are coilovers; which are basically height adjustable springs. V2's also have damper control so you can adjust the stiffness of your shocks. I have the stiffness on my shocks dialed down to OEM sport suspension. Rides like butter.

Coilover systems always replace both your springs and shocks, but sometimes the shocks are not adjustable (i.e. H&R Coilovers).

You can adjust the height evenly by measuring the collar on each side or you can just eyeball it like I did.
